Understanding crosshair customization in CS2 is essential for enhancing your gameplay experience. A well-configured crosshair can significantly improve your aiming precision. Within the settings menu, players can adjust various parameters to create a crosshair that suits their playing style. Key settings include adjusting the size, thickness, and color, allowing players to personalize their crosshair to enhance visibility against different backgrounds. Furthermore, the ability to change opacity and outline can help in distinguishing the crosshair from the in-game environment, ultimately providing a competitive edge.
When delving deeper into crosshair customization, it's important to explore the advanced options available in CS2. Players can modify settings such as the dynamic nature of the crosshair, which changes size based on movement and shooting, thereby providing feedback on player actions. Additionally, configuring the center gap and adjusting the spread can offer finer control over aiming precision. To help you navigate these settings effectively, consider creating a reference list of your preferred configurations to optimize your crosshair for different game scenarios. Ultimately, finding the right balance between aesthetics and functionality is key for a personalized aiming experience.

The choice of crosshair style in CS2 can significantly impact a player's performance, as it influences both aiming precision and overall gameplay experience. A well-designed crosshair can enhance visibility and focus, allowing players to concentrate on their targets without unnecessary distractions. For instance, dynamic crosshairs expand during movement and shrink when stationary, providing real-time feedback that helps players adjust their aim based on their movement status. Conversely, static crosshairs maintain a consistent appearance, which can be beneficial for players who prefer a more traditional aiming approach. Understanding the nuances of these styles can help players tailor their setup to improve reaction times and accuracy.
Moreover, different crosshair colors contribute to visibility and contrast against various backgrounds, which can be critical in a fast-paced game like CS2. Players often experiment with high-contrast colors such as bright green or vibrant pink to ensure maximum visibility, especially in map areas with chaotic elements. Additionally, crosshair thickness and circumference can also affect how players perceive their aim; a thicker crosshair may provide a more substantial visual anchor, while a thinner crosshair could increase precision for skilled players. Finding the right balance in crosshair customization not only enhances performance but can also lead to significant gameplay improvements.
In Counter-Strike 2, your crosshair is one of the most crucial elements that can significantly influence your aiming ability. Many players make common mistakes that can sabotage their performance and hinder their aim. For instance, using a static crosshair in a game filled with dynamic movement can lead to poor accuracy. It's essential to remember that your crosshair should not only be visible but should complement your playstyle. Consider experimenting with different sizes, styles, and colors to find a crosshair that provides maximum visibility and comfort while you engage in firefights.
Another prevalent mistake is neglecting crosshair placement. Players often aim at the ground or the walls instead of keeping their crosshair at head level, which results in slower reaction times when encountering opponents. To improve your aim in CS2, practice maintaining your crosshair at the average height of your enemies and anticipate their movements. By adjusting your crosshair position and being mindful of it during gameplay, you can significantly enhance your accuracy and response time, making a notable difference in your performance.
